Unlike most cruisers, the enjoys nimble handling with excellent high-speed stability. Sportbike-style 43mm inverted forks and a reinforced swingarm with dual air-assisted hydraulic shocks aid handling, while still offering enough compliance to offer the smooth journey demanded by cruiser riders. Dual radial-mount front disc brakes and four-piston calipers lend additional street credibility and excellent stopping power to the 's bag of tricks. The Vulcan 1600 's 1,552cc V-twin engine offers a smooth wave of torque to make your ride more entertaining, thanks to high-tech features like liquid cooling, electronic fuel injection, dual spark plug digital ignition and 4 valves per cylinder. In the cruiser world, appearances and rider comfort are every bit as important as massive power, so polished the valve covers and cooling fins for a bright, high-performance image. Schwantz, Tsujimoto Team Up For Yoshimura Legends Team At 2014 Suzuka 8-Hour

Sat, 01 Mar 2014

Former 500cc World Champion, Kevin Schwantz, will pair with former Japanese Champion, Satoshi Tsujimoto, in this year’s Suzuka 8-Hour race. The duo originally tackled Suzuka together in 1986, ultimately coming in third position. Now the two are back in celebration of Yoshimura’s 60th anniversary, as part of the company’s “Legend Team.” Yoshimura will also field a second entry with former Australian Champion Josh Waters and All Japan Superbike rider Takuya Tsuda.

WSBK 2013: Monza Race Report

Mon, 13 May 2013

Eugene Laverty and Marco Melandri split a pair of victories at Monza but the most biggest news from the World Superbike weekend was a strange series of appeals after Race Two that saw Tom Sykes finish third, relegated to fourth and then reinstated on the final step of the podium. The unusual mix-up occurred after Sykes, sitting in third place, ran off track and into the run off area on Turn 5 on his final lap. The Kawasaki rider returned to the track again in third place where he finished ahead of Aprilia‘s Sylvain Guintoli.
